I moved from Iceland to Uppsala expecting somewhat of a fairytale, so I was honestly pretty surprised by my experience working here.
In Iceland, there is often a strong focus on becoming more like the other Nordic countries, especially Sweden, and I had always seen Sweden as a country with high standards, strong worker protections and good working conditions. That made my experience here even more unexpected.
I worked as a mover/driver for a moving/cleaning company where I had issues with how my hours and wages were calculated. When I started asking questions and wanted clarification about my pay, the situation became increasingly difficult. I eventually stopped receiving shifts and was later let go. The issue stems on was how certain jobs were quoted. They were paid on a fixed quote without my knowledge, while my payslip showed 152 SEK/hour. Some jobs took much longer than the quoted time, resulting in up to hundreds of unpaid hours.
I also reached out to different authorities and organizations for help, and even though I had evidence of them breaking major EU and Swedish labour laws I unfortunately didn't get the help I needed.
What also surprised me was how difficult it seemed to find other job opportunities. When people have limited options for work, it can put them in a position where they feel they have to tolerate poor working conditions because they can't simply walk away. This was the case with almost all my former colleagues. None of them could speak up or else...
Unfortunately, this experience contributed to my decision to move back to Iceland. I really liked Sweden and it's people and had hoped to build a life here, so it's disappointing that my experience at work ended up being such a major factor in leaving.
